After Being Detained 20 Days, Gas Vessel to Arrive in Hodeida Port

Sana’a-based Yemen Gas Company (YGC) confirmed on Thursday that the gas vessel “Claudia Gas” loaded with 8,249 metric tons of imported gas will arrive at the port of Hodeida in the coming hours.

Yemen Gas Company spokesman Ali Me’asar told SABA that the vessel’s release came after it had been detained for 20 days by the Saudi-led coalition.

The Saudi coalition continued to engage in maritime piracy on oil and gas derivatives vessels and their seizure, thereby compounding citizens’ suffering.

Me’asar pointed out that the process of unloading the vessel will be initiated by the technical, financing and commercial team, commissioned by the company, upon its arrival.
